Description

The data included shows the cooling strategies used in 51 different buildings in the world, the type of climate in which the measurements were implemented and the variables of temperature, air velocity and relative humidity inside the buildings are also included. . The data can be interpreted in different ways, with them different types of studies can be carried out, such as correlations, feeding of larger databases such as ASHRAE standards, analysis of parameters with advanced statistics. These are essential data to understand the thermal performance of buildings in the world and its impact on aspects of thermal comfort and energy consumption. The data was obtained from the search for information articles in specialized scientists, the information search was carried out in engines such as Scopus, Google Scholar and ScienceDirect. These data can be used for global analysis of cooling strategies, bioclimatic comfort, analysis of hygrothermal parameters in different buildings and regions of the world.
